Output 52e8c54b79303305255bd5a11f07591a8965f5d7bd0c342932173874c48fa85b:4

value
39707288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6501428b8b2733082ef347de17d3e2fd6d9026f OP_EQUAL
address
MQX99K4NgdMDbYzEZeBQuHk74hkuY9LSpS
transaction
52e8c54b79303305255bd5a11f07591a8965f5d7bd0c342932173874c48fa85b
spent
true